Understanding Your Stretching Needs

Choosing the right stretching studio in Stamford begins with understanding your personal fitness goals and needs. Are you looking for a studio that focuses on flexibility, stress relief, or injury prevention? Knowing your objectives will help you narrow down your choices and find a studio that aligns with your specific goals.

Consider whether you prefer a group class setting or individualized attention from a personal instructor. Both have their benefits, with group classes offering a sense of community and personal sessions providing tailored guidance.

Researching Studio Options

With your goals in mind, start researching studios in Stamford. Look for reviews and testimonials from past clients to gauge the studio's reputation. Online platforms and social media can provide insights into the experiences of other members, helping you make an informed decision.

Visit the studio's website to check their class schedules, instructor qualifications, and any unique offerings they might have. A well-rounded program with various class levels can be a significant advantage as you progress in your stretching journey.

Evaluating the Instructors

The quality of instructors is paramount when selecting a stretching studio. Look for studios that employ certified and experienced instructors. Certifications from reputable organizations can assure you of their expertise in teaching safe and effective stretching techniques.

Consider attending a trial class to observe the instructors' teaching styles and how they interact with students. This firsthand experience can be invaluable in determining if their approach aligns with your learning preferences.

Checking the Studio Atmosphere

The atmosphere of a stretching studio plays a crucial role in your overall experience. Visit the studios on your shortlist to get a feel for the environment. Is it welcoming and clean? Does it provide a calming and motivating space conducive to relaxation and focus?

Pay attention to the facilities offered, such as mats, props, and lockers. A well-equipped studio enhances your comfort and convenience during classes, making your sessions more enjoyable.

Assessing Class Schedules and Pricing

Flexibility in class schedules is essential, especially if you have a busy lifestyle. Check if the studio offers classes at times that fit into your routine. Some studios might provide early morning or late evening classes to accommodate different schedules.

Compare pricing structures between different studios. Look for membership options, drop-in rates, and any special packages or promotions that might be available. Ensure that the pricing aligns with the value you receive from the classes offered.

Trial Classes and Membership Options

Many studios offer trial classes or introductory packages for new students. Taking advantage of these options allows you to experience the studio firsthand without a long-term commitment. Use this opportunity to assess whether the studio meets your expectations in terms of instruction quality, atmosphere, and community.

Once you've found a studio that feels right, explore their membership options. Some studios offer flexible memberships with benefits such as discounted rates or access to special events and workshops.
